Transaction 51c6380f2aa8d2184176ce43593a07cc36edf3f0193289758f26460e704644f4
1 Input
1 Output
-
51c6380f2aa8d2184176ce43593a07cc36edf3f0193289758f26460e704644f4:0
- value
- 3956
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 700ea027c4945bc23532139d2bc63b1b43ebf11a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BDWCh273ZpfvvFsKH4w6T1yr26zSecQnX